POSITION SUMMARY
Under general supervision the Facility Assistant Janitor is responsible for maintaining a clean and orderly Building / Facility. Work is performed with some independence within established policies procedures and techniques and is subject to general or direct supervision as the work situation warrants.
As part of the DSV team Associates are expected to meet company objectives in the areas of performance safety and quality. Associates are expected to comply with all corporate and site-specific policies.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Maintain offices cubical conference rooms restrooms and or any other office space clean and in orderly fashion.
- Prepare conference rooms with coffee drinks and or food (when required)
- Maintain Storage areas (neat and clean)
- Maintains cleanliness of exterior grounds (bay areas lobby entrances etc.)
- Empty trash receptacles in the warehouse daily at a minimum.
- Maintain floors daily to ensure cleanliness no dirt and debris obstacles and trip/slip hazards. Post hazard information signs where needed.
- Maintain materials in a neat clean and orderly fashion.
